Admission to this college is determined through entrance exams like KCET, JEE, and COMEDK, with document verification and online college selection as part of the process. Students with KCET ranks between 20,000 and 23,000 have gained admission to branches such as Industrial and Production Engineering. The admission process involves three rounds, with placements beginning after the first. Fee structures vary: KCET admissions incur around Rs. 28,000 per year for aided seats and Rs.
52,000 for unaided seats, while COMEDK students pay over Rs. 1 lakh annually. Management seats are pricier, ranging from Rs. 8 to 20 lakhs annually, based on the course. The college boasts a highly qualified faculty, particularly in the Mathematics and Physics departments, known for their effective teaching methods. Placement opportunities are strong, with over 80 companies participating. 60% of students secure jobs, with placement rates of 60-70% in the mechanical branch and 50-60% in Industrial and Production Engineering.
Computer Science placements are particularly successful, although hardware-focused outcomes are less favorable. Internships are available in the 3rd and 4th years, with variable stipends starting at 1500 INR. Scholarships, such as the Karnataka E-pass, support students based on academic merit, income, and caste, with a dedicated scholarship department assisting in applications. The fee structure is affordable compared to other institutions, but no loan facilities are offered.
